Transaction 77baeda19b15f8f40928266b47f871ac21c53f5f18ea510a8658d318bb5f16ea

block
75006ef3cbb3f86c38e6e0c24ed1a3a5396686eae84f71dfc7b35314e544196c

1 Input

23 Outputs